GCSE Results Day 2018: Oaklands School pupil gets clean sweep of top grade
Oaklands School pupil Taklima Yesmin, who got straight 9s in her GCSEs, with headteacher Patrice Canavan. Picture: Oaklands School - Credit: Oaklands School
An Oaklands School pupil is celebrating picking up nine grade 9s -the highest possible - in her GCSEs.
Taklima Yesmin said she was “absolutely shocked” by how well she did in her exams.
She said: “I cannot believe I got these results!
“it’s not about being naturally smart, it’s all about putting in the hard work.
“I would never in a million years have thought I would get straight 9s. Hard work really does pay off!”
